I'm posting this query on behalf of a neighbour. He has used a silicone based filler in the past to fill a crack in the house exterior plaster before painting but the crack becomes visible again some time afterwards. Can somebody please recommend a good quality outdoor filler which will give more permanent results? Regards Patrick.


The same cracks will appear and reappear forever as this is slight foundation movement. You don't say what type of rendering thats on the wall?

the only solution I can think of is to put some gauze or plasteres scrim over the crack and fill over that.

I've found dry wall adhesive a good filler for outside if its painted afterwards,this adhesive is basically for interior plastering but dries rock solid like concrete. The only snag is it comes in big bags. :-( maybe if he knows who's about to plaster might hand him some?

Most paints don't adhere to silicone very well. Most hardware stores will sell acrylic based sealants/gap fillers which are paintable.
